I’ve been a Godzilla fan for years now, and all of the previews made Godzilla: Singular Point look like a show that was practically made for me. It features slick character designs and lovely 2D artwork from the venerable Studio Bones, and the work for all of Singular Point‘s incredibly unique looking creatures and robots are handled by Studio Orange, who are perhaps the industry leaders in creating stylish and well-blended 3D CG for television anime. Godzilla’s new look was especially appealing to me, as it has perhaps the most in common with what we saw in Hideaki Anno‘s Shin Godzilla. There’s not a hint of anthropomorphic humanity in this iteration of the King of the Monsters — he’s completely alien, and beyond empathy. A true creature of paradigm smashing destruction.
